Hiker Survives Blizzard in Grouse Butt


Who: A 32-year-old hiker from London
Where: Langdon Beck, UK
His mistake: Got lost on the trail
What happened: A man went for a hike and lost the trail in a blizzard that brought heavy snow that was drifting more than 5 feet high.

He found shelter in a grouse butt, an enclosure in the hills for grouse shooters. Some grouse butts have roofs. It is unclear what kind of protection the man received.

Family members didn’t report the man missing until two days later when they haven’t heard from him. Immediately, 55 rescue members braved the blizzard conditions to find him.

They found the man 2,200 feet up the mountain and two miles from his intended route. He was properly equipped for the conditions and was in pretty good condition when he was found.

Authorities say it is pretty easy to get lost in the area he was hiking due to the featureless terrain with no landmarks to help guide people back to the trailhead.
